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5920247362 6844019791 554209707 89031038904 63047
3562 4595641411 007155
3562 4595641411 007155
67359560 02879 516254
All about undefined
Interested in learning more?
3562 4595641411 007155
67359560 02879 516254
See more
965687289 09 692944364
69 3557492 680099 1268
See more
742 2358
52951587933 2743 7357
See more